Constituency in the Senate of Spain
La Rioja is one of the 59 constituencies (Spanish: circunscripciones ) represented in the Senate of Spain , the upper chamber of the Spanish parliament, the Cortes Generales . The constituency elects four senators . Its boundaries correspond to those of the Spanish province of La Rioja . The electoral system uses an open list partial block voting , with electors voting for individual candidates instead of parties. Electors can vote for up to three candidates.
